    Ocado is a big U.K. grocery retailer who're into automation. The video on their packing warehouse is pretty interesting: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=4DKrcpa8Z_E But the UK has the population density (and much smaller geographic area than Australia) to support infrastructure like this.

    Kroger, one of the U.S.'s largest grocery retailers, is partnering with Ocado and has started building these warehouses in USA too: https://www.supermarketnews.com/retail-financial/kroger-breaks-ground-first-ocado-warehouse - so this technology can also be applied to larger area countries, like the U.S. - but USA has ~15x the population that Australia has and hence the demand can support the capital outlay, for this kind of investment.

    Can Woolies deploy something like this in Australia? I would think that on some scale it could be useful in the high population areas like Sydney, Melbourne and Brisbane. But outside of those? Probably not so much IMO.
